The latest such opportunity is "clustering," whereby you dump all of your DNA matches into a data file and convert them into color-coded groups based on who is related to each other. Basically, this is an amplification of the "LEEDS METHOD," developed a few years ago by researcher Dana Leeds. (Read all about it at https://www.danaleeds.com/the-leeds-method.)

In examining all of my clusters, I noticed the matches I find from my dad's side of the family outnumber the matches from my mom's side by about a 3-to-1 ratio. And I wondered why that number was so relatively LARGE . . . pun definitely intended.
Drilling down further, I notice I have at least 7 identifiable matches for each of Dad's 32 third-great grandparents. But one couple has a disproportionately LARGE number of matches at 126 each: Isaac Timmons and his wife Sarah Davis, who lived at Mount Croghan, South Carolina, in the decades leading up to the Civil War.
If YOU find this sort of disproportionality in your own results, fret not. This is typical. There are two main reasons why this happens:
- Fertility rates. One side of your family may consistently have LARGE numbers of children, while another side has a history of only one or two children per generation. The lines with multiple generations of multiple births will obviously produce more potential living matches, but that doesn't mean you inherited more DNA from your most recent common ancestors.
- Who is taking tests? Common sense tells us if you have a bunch of cousins from one branch of the family who are testing while very few cousins from another branch are submitting their DNA, the totals are going to be lopsided. Many factors come into play here. One group of cousins may be more interested in genealogy because their branch of the family belongs to the LDS church, while another group may have an aversion to DNA testing due to privacy concerns. But varying participation rates do not mean you have more DNA from one pair of ancestors over another.
These apply to my own results. In the case of Isaac and Sarah Timmons, they had a LARGE family of thirteen children. All of these children survived to adulthood (a rare achievement in that era) and all but the youngest boy (who marched off to fight in the Civil War and never returned) went on to marry and produce large families of their own. By my count, Isaac and Sarah had no fewer than 115 grandchildren!
